Golfer shot upon at Deerfield Country Club
A golfer was shot in the back during a robbery attempt at the Deerfield Country Club in Florida on Thursday evening.
A 35-year-old golfer was near the 17th hole with another golfer when two masked men who had been hiding in nearby bushes, came out and tried to rob them. Soon after, the two men opened fire which left one of the golfers seriously injured.
The greenkeeper, who is witness to the case, called the police at 6.30 pm and reported the whole incident. The police reached the venue at 6.45 pm and rushed the man who was bleeding profusely to the North Broward Medical Centre, which was the nearest hospital
in the vicinity.
Greenkeeper Nicole McCarthy said, “At 6.30 in the evening, two men whose faces were masked in black came out of the bushes on the 17th green and started talking to the two golfers. They seemed like robbers. A few minutes later, they opened gunfire
on the player. As soon as they found him lying in blood, they flee from the scene. We called the police, who later took the charge of the case.”
Mike Jachles, a spokesperson from the Sheriff’s office told the press that the name of the victim could not be disclosed because of a political reason. He also refused to comment on the reason behind the murder attempt. However, the hospital staff told the
media that the patient underwent a surgery and was in critical condition.
The police started the search mission right after the case was reported. They used a helicopter and K9 search teams to search the golf course, which is located on top of Hillsboro Boulevard. Despite looking extensively, they failed to find the suspects.
The spokesperson from the Sheriff’s office added that the reason behind the failure of search mission was lack of complete information. The police did not have the description of the robbers and therefore, they could not find them. However, the flying squad
reported two men running towards the residential area at 7.00 pm.
Several crimes like this have been reported in the past on various golf courses, owing to lack of security.
